Galileo was the first person to describe projectile motion accurately, by breaking down motion into a horizontal and vertical component, and realizing that the plot of any object's motion would always be a parabola. The vertical acceleration is equal to -g since gravity is the only force which acts on the projectile.

Again, if we're launching the object from the ground (initial height = 0), then we can write the formula as R = Vx * t = Vx * 2 * Vy / g. It may be also transformed into the form: R = V² * sin(2α) / g. Things are getting more complicated for initial elevation differing from 0.
